Output d31534219d9a77ae383f523dfaa584275d50c83db14cd565c58005450076e04d:160

value
321451
script pubkey
OP_0 OP_PUSHBYTES_20 e1507702cdeb7bc554549edc70cc7b43cbd07421
address
bc1qu9g8wqkdadau24z5nmw8pnrmg09aqappxv250x
transaction
d31534219d9a77ae383f523dfaa584275d50c83db14cd565c58005450076e04d